What Is Estate Planning?
Estate planning involves preparing to transfer your assets after your death and protecting your rights if you are unable to make decisions for yourself. It includes creating documents like wills, trusts, and powers of attorney to ensure that your property is distributed according to your wishes. Estate planning also covers issues like minimizing taxes, protecting beneficiaries, and managing health care decisions if you become incapacitated. The goal is to provide clear instructions and avoid legal complications for your loved ones.
What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need an Estate Planning Lawyer?
You might need an estate planning lawyer if you:
- Want to draft a will or set up a trust to manage your assets
- Have a large or complex estate and want to minimize taxes for your loved ones
- Own a business and want control to pass to the right person
- Have specific wishes for your health care that everyone must follow if you cannot communicate them yourself
- Need to plan for the care of your minor children
- Already have an estate plan but need to update it after a major life change like marriage, divorce, or the birth of a child

What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ire an Estate Planning Lawyer?
If you don’t hire an estate planning lawyer, your documents might not meet legal requirements, causing your estate plan to be invalid. This could lead to your assets being distributed according to Virginia law rather than your wishes. Without proper planning, your estate might face higher taxes and legal fees, reducing the amount left for your beneficiaries. Additionally, without a clear plan, your family could face disputes and legal challenges. A lawyer helps ensure your estate is managed smoothly and according to your wishes, providing peace of mind for you and your loved ones.
